毕业论文
计算机论文
经济论文
生物论文
数学论文
物理论文
机械论文
新闻传播论文
音乐舞蹈论文
法学论文
文学论文
材料科学
英语论文
日语论文
化学论文
自动化
管理论文
艺术论文
会计论文
土木工程
电子通信
食品科学
教学论文
医学论文
体育论文
论文下载
研究现状
任务书
开题报告
外文文献翻译
文献综述
范文
多智能体分布式纯方位编队控制算法研究(3)
现有的论文讨论的主要都是三到四个智能体[9],而它们采用的纯方位编队控制算法不适用于智能体数量更多的智能体系统,因此有必要探索出一种能拓展到数量更多的纯方位编队控制算法。
(4)纯方位编队规模控制问题。
事实上,纯方位编队控制的编队规模是不可控的,而基于距离测量的编队控制可以确定编队的大小。可以采用距离和方位混合控制来确定编队的规模[8],但这一方法需要额外的量测信息。
(5)避免碰撞问题。
任何编队控制问题都要求避免碰撞,但是没有距离测量避免碰撞又难以实现[7]。对于分散式纯方位多智能体编队问题,要如何避免碰撞是一个亟待解决的方向。
1.4 本文主要研究内容
本文的研究课题是多智能体分布式纯方位编队控制算法,第二部分主要对较为基础的多智能体纯方位三角形编队控制算法进行了介绍和分析,并用matlab进行了仿真实验;由于传统的多智能体纯方位三角形编队控制算法无法对编队队形的规模进行控制,因而第三部分结合距离和角度测量对三角形编队控制算法进行研究,并进行了仿真实验。针对三个以上智能体纯方位编队控制算法的问题,本文第四部分对这一问题进行了介绍和分析,并用matlab对进行了相应的仿真实验。验证了上述几种算法的可行性,并对仿真结果进行了分析和总结。
此外,在多智能体纯方位三角形编队控制算法中,还研究了多智能体系统遇到单个智能体无法移动和多智能体拥有相同的组速度情况下的编队控制。研究距离角度混合约束的三角形编队控制算法时,由于其是一种非紧约束的算法,对其在个别参数固定和运动中参数不停变化两种情况下进行仿真讨论。最后在对三个以上智能体纯方位编队控制算法中,不仅讨论仿真了理想情况下的编队控制,而且对测量存在误差情况下的编队控制进行了仿真分析。
2 多智能体纯方位三角形编队控制
2.1 控制对象及控制问题描述
我们考虑一组在平面 ,智能体数量为 的多智能体系统,每个智能体通过无向拓扑相互连接,定义多智能体系统 ,其中顶点集 表示每个智能体, 为各智能体间的连接集合。每个智能体的位置是 ,智能体 的邻居集合 表示存在一条通信链路到智能体 的节点的集合。在三角形编队控制问题中,令, 。
为了方便编队的角度控制,引入智能体间的夹角 , 表示 集合里智能体 的两个邻居智能体朝向智能体 所成的夹角。显而易见,编队的形状完全取决于 , 。为了方便 的计算,首先从智能体 的局部坐标系 方向起始朝向智能体 测量方位,测量角度为 , (数值为正是逆时针,负数则为顺时针)。可得
(1)
, 分别是智能体 在局部坐标系朝向智能体 和智能体 的角度, 是智能体 智能体 朝向智能体 所成的夹角,其范围是 到 。因此可以给出夹角
(2)
其中 。另外这里要注意 和 的含义不同,两者都说明三个智能体共线,但 指明了智能体 在智能体 和智能体 的一侧,而 说明智能体 在智能体 和智能体 的中间。
图1.1三角形智能体角度示意图
定义期望获得的稳定状态下编队的角度为 。那么 完全确定了期望的三角形编队形状,但是不能确定编队的规模大小。
引入假设:
假设1 期望的内角 (即控制的目标),满足 。这里排除 , 和 的情况。
共4页:
上一页
1
2
3
4
下一页
上一篇:
基于VC和Fluent开发油罐目标温度场求解软件
下一篇:
matlab基于多体系统传递矩阵法的旋翼无人机建模与分析研究
动车组滚动轴承FCM智能诊断研究
基于51单片机自动门智能控制系统设计
STC89C52单片机智能温度监测系统设计
动车组滚动轴承SVM智能诊断研究
连续梁结构上动态多点激励识别研究+源代码
MATLAB动车组滚动轴承RBF智能诊断研究
Arduino的家居智能安防系统的设计+程序+电路图
浅谈传统人文精神茬大學...
辩护律师的作证义务和保...
拉力采集上位机软件开发任务书
中国古代秘书擅权的发展和恶变
高校网球场馆运营管理初探【1805字】
《醉青春》导演作品阐述
多元化刑事简易程序构建探讨【9365字】
国内外无刷直流电动机研究现状
谷度酒庄消费者回访调查问卷表
浅谈新形势下妇产科护理...